ecoWise shareholders call for yet another EGM to remove deputy CEO, appoint new directors
FOURTEEN shareholders of strife-hit ecoWise Holdings have called for yet another extraordinary general meeting (EGM) of the company to remove its deputy CEO Cao Shixuan after a previous attempt to hold an EGM for the same purpose was brought to an end by a High Court injunction.
 
In a notice sent to ecoWise dated Oct 22 by the EGM requisitionists and seen by The Business Times, the shareholders - which hold over 118 million ecoWise shares or approximately 12.5 per cent of the total number of paid-up shares of the company - have called for the EGM to be held on Nov 26, no later than 28 days from the date of the notice.
 
The shareholders include previous EGM requisitionists Tan Swee Boon and Winston Tan Jin Beng as well as ecoWise founder and CEO Lee Thiam Seng who has been involved in a publicised tussle with Cao.
 
The resolutions to be tabled at this EGM include the removal of Cao as a director of the company and " for all necessary steps to be taken to remove him from all appointments with the company, its subsidiaries and its associated and investee companies" .
 
Other resolutions include the appointment of Dr Danny Oh Beng Teck, Gan Fong Jek and Allan Tan Poh Chye as directors of the company.
 
In their notice, the requisitionists have also asked for ecoWise to publish a copy of the notice on SGXNet and the company' s website by Oct 26.
 
ecoWise has not issued an announcement on this requisition nor has it posted a copy of the notice on SGXNet at this time.
 
A previous requisition for an EGM - to vote on Cao' s removal as well as on the appointment of new directors - could not proceed after the High Court on Aug 12 granted an interim injunction of the meeting.
 
The injunction application had been brought before the court by Cao who is also an executive director at ecoWise, the Catalist company had said in a bourse filing the day before the proposed EGM was to be held.
 
ecoWise had also appointed two new independent directors effective Sept 3 following a notice of compliance issued by Singapore Exchange Regulation (SGX RegCo) on June 25. The notice ordered the company to appoint two new independent directors, commission an internal audit and an audit of its first-half 2021 results and form a new auditing committee.
 
SGX RegCo said then that it was concerned about the " lack of a strong and independent element on the board" , the accuracy of the company' s H1 2021 results, the adequacy and effectiveness of internal controls in relation to ecoWise' s financial reporting, release of announcements, escalation and information flow to the board and the safeguarding of the group' s assets.

ecoWise appoints two independent directors in wake of SGX RegCo' s compliance notice
TROUBLED environmental solutions provider ecoWise Holdings has hired two independent directors, effective Sept 3.
 
These appointments come after bourse regulator Singapore Exchange Regulation (SGX RegCo) slapped the company with a notice of compliance on June 25, ordering it to appoint two new independent directors, commission an internal audit and an audit of its first-half 2021 results and form a new auditing committee.
 
The first appointment is Lo Kim Seng, as an independent non-executive director. Mr Lo was also appointed as the chairman of the remuneration committee, as well as a member of both the audit and nominating committees.
 
The 59-year-old is also currently serving on the boards of other Singapore-listed companies. He is an independent non-executive director of Fragrance Group, the lead independent director of No Signboard Holdings, and an independent director of CFM Holdings.
 
The second appointment announced by the group is Tham Chee Soon, who will serve as an independent non-executive director, chairman of the audit committee and a member of both the nominating and remuneration committees.
 
The 56-year-old is currently also a non-executive independent director at Fragrance Group and Hwa Hong Corporation.
 
Mr Tham was also an audit partner at EY Singapore from 2004 till his retirement in June 2018, and reportedly has 31 years' experience in the accounting field.
 
ecoWise' s board of directors said they are of the view that the appointments of both Mr Lo and Mr Tham will " enhance the effectiveness of the board and be beneficial to the company" . The board also said that it has assessed the qualifications, expertise, work experience and competencies of both individuals.
 
ecoWise suspended the trading of its shares on June 18 following a trading halt called on June 15. The counter last traded at 7.8 Singapore cents on June 14.

High Court grants interim injunction prohibiting ecoWise EGM from convening
STRIFE-HIT ecoWise Holdings will not be able to proceed with an extraordinary general meeting (EGM) to vote on the removal of its deputy chief executive, after the High Court on Thursday granted an interim injunction of the meeting.
 
The injunction application was brought before the court by deputy CEO Cao Shixuan, who is also an executive director at ecoWise, the Catalist company said in a bourse filing late on Thursday - a day before the proposed EGM was to be held.
 
Mr Cao, through his lawyers at CNPLaw, had served a writ of summons on the company' s founder and CEO Lee Thiam Seng, and shareholders Tan Wee Boon and Tan Jin Beng Winston. The latter two had called for the EGM to remove Mr Cao and to appoint three new directors - Damien Seah, Nichol Yeo and Calvin Tan.
 
ecoWise had said last Friday that any resolutions passed at the proposed EGM would be deemed invalid as valid notice had not been given for the meeting.
In his writ of summons, Mr Cao is claiming that the three defendants had conducted the company' s affairs and exercised powers of its directors in a manner that was " oppressive" , and that disregarded his interest as a director and member of the company.
 
Mr Cao has also claimed that holding the EGM on Aug 13 " unfairly discriminates against the plaintiff" , said ecoWise' s announcement, which was signed off by lead independent director Er Kwong Wah.
 
The same writ of summons was served on ecoWise as a " nominee defendant" , but Mr Cao is not seeking any remedies against the company.
 
The order will stand until the matter proceeds to trial, or when the court makes a further order.
 
The shareholders who called for the meeting told BT last month that they had notified ecoWise of the EGM on July 16 and had provided the company with a notice of EGM and a proxy form for the intended meeting. They said they had asked ecoWise to release the notice and proxy form in a bourse announcement and on the company' s website, but it had not done so.
